Compare GLP-1 pens

Brand-name and compounded options available to Sherwood patients

PenMoleculeApproved forFrequencyTypical price
Ozempic Semaglutide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$950–$1,350/mo
Wegovy Semaglutide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,300–$1,400/mo
Mounjaro Tirzepatide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$1,000–$1,200/mo
Zepbound Tirzepatide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,000–$1,060/mo
Compounded Semaglutide / Tirzepatide Cash-pay telehealth option Once weekly $199–$499/mo

Prices are typical U.S. cash-pay ranges without insurance; manufacturer savings cards and coverage can lower brand-name costs significantly.

What to expect: dosing & side effects

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ection, starting at a low dose that your provider increases gradually over several weeks to limit side effects. Most Sherwood patients self-inject at home after a short demonstration.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ns; GLP-1s should not be used by people with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N 2. Your provider reviews your full history before prescribing.

Clinical trials show tirzepatide (Mounjaro/Zepbound) produces greater average weight loss (up to ~22.5% of body weight) than semaglutide (Ozempic/Wegovy, ~15–17%). Tirzepatide activates two receptors (GLP-1 and GIP) versus one for semaglutide. Both are highly effective; your Sherwood provider helps choose based on your history and goals.

In clinical trials, semaglutide patients lost about 15% of body weight and tirzepatide patients up to 22.5% over roughly 68–72 weeks on the highest dose. For a 200-pound person that is roughly 30–45 pounds. Results in Sherwood vary with diet, activity and starting weight.

Coverage varies widely by plan in Wisconsin. Many commercial plans cover Mounjaro for diabetes and Wegovy/Zepbound for weight management with prior authorization. Medicare Part D may cover diabetes indications but generally not weight-loss use. A Sherwood provider can verify benefits and file prior authorization.

Both are semaglutide from Novo Nordisk. Ozempic is FDA-approved for type 2 diabetes (often used off-label for weight loss), while Wegovy is approved specifically for chronic weight management at a higher dose. Same molecule, different indication and dosing.
